Deja

Deja is the first born of William and Demetra Washington, and she was born and raised in Washington, DC.  She is the First Place Winner of the 2005 Billboards 13th Annual Song Writing Contest under Christian/Gospel Category with the song "Raise Up and Praise Him".  Deja knew from the beginning her destiny has been led by the Holy Spirit of God.  Deja, born Deletra J. Washington, developed under the guidance of her father, a music master in his own right, who passed on vocal training to her at an early age.  As a toddler, Deja showed her talent and early love of Classical music by humming Beethoven's Fifth symphony in C minor, which also later on prompted her to study and excel in playing the violin while in grade school.  Deja has been exposed and trained in classical, Gospel, and R&B music from the start.  She has come from a long line of singers and musicians starting with her grandfather, Richard Blandon, of a Doo Wop group called the Dubbs.  Her mother was also a singer along with a long list of others in in her family - Deja could not help but sing.  

Deja formed  and sang in a gospel quartet called One Voice.  The group participated in talent shows and performances all over the DC area.  Deja released her first demo at the age of 16 and is now anticipating the release of her debut album independently later in 2006.  Deja continues to sing God's praises wherever she goes.
